Revision List: Tuesday 7th May 2024

———————————————————————————————————————————

Topic 1.1

1. Denary, Binary & Hex conversions


2. Binary Additions
3. Two’s complement, representing negative denary and binary numbers
4. Two’s complement conversions
5. The use of hexadecimal and describe each of the them clearly and provide examples
6. Characteristics of MAC address
7. Characteristics of IP Address
8. Di erences between MAC Address and IP Addresses
9. Di erence between Static and Dynamic IP addresses
10. The two version of IP addresses IPv4 & IPv6
11. Performing logical binary shift on positive 8-bit register
12. Understand the e ect of Left & Right Logical shifts
13. Over ow error in a 8-bit register if the value is over 255
14. When does an over ow error occurs

Topic 1.2

1. Understand how and why a computer represents text


2. Understand the use of character sets, and be able de ne a character set.
3. Understand ASCII & Unicode, number of bits and bytes to represents each character
4. Understand that one byte s use to store each ASCII character, however only 7 bits is used.
5. Understand the disadvantage of using ASCII and Unicode
6. Understand how and why a computer represents sound.
7. Understand the e ects of the sample rate and sample resolution
8. Be able describe the term sample rate and sample resolution
9. Be able to describe the accuracy of recording.
10. Understand the impact of high quality recording, including increasing sample rate and
resolution
11. Understand how and why a computer represents images
12. Understand the resolution and colour depth of an image.
13. Understand the quality and le size of an image, and the e ect of increasing the colour depth
and resolution.
———————————————————————————————————————————
Topic 1.3

1. Understand data storage, bit to exbibyte and the how to convert between the units
2. Understand how to calculate the le size of an image and a sound le in a given unit.
3. Understand the purpose and the need for data compression
4. Understand the advantage of data compression, I.e less bandwidth, less storage space,
shorter transmission time.
5. Understand how le are compressed using lossy and lossless compression methods
6. Understand and be able to describe how RLE compression works
7. Understand that reducing resolution or colour depth, reducing sample rate or resolution is
used with lossy compression.
